¿Whaté THE STAKES SAYístatic?
Despite the recent events, the statesíSticas Histórich support the safety of aviationón. The accidents toéinmates are relatively rare in comparisonón with other means of transport, Like automócities. The chances of suffering an accident toéinmate are extremely low.
The best portal that carries this data, ASN, reveló The data statesíPassenger and Private Commercial Aircraft Stics (No airplanes are counted 12 passengers that are not military, aerolíthe corporate):

As we can see, The trend is kept down from 1995, the Año más fatal from 1990 is shown in the table. At 95 They occurred 64 accidents, at 2020 It was reduced to 21.

In the sense of the deceased, The peak took place in 1994 with 1.887 víCities in accidentséprisoners, while in the 2024 This figure was reduced to 289, demonstrating industry efforts toéREA for offering us a transport ráI ask, efficient and safe.

List of accidents and incidents:
It is certain that some events are missing on the list, If they have them, They can share them in the comments to update the list.
- December 2024:
- 19 from December: Coalonie atr 72 – Tail blow (Ouju).
- 22 from December: Emerald UK ATR 72 – Hardly landing and collapse of the front landing train (Belfast).
- 23 from December: Swiss Airbus A220-300 – Motor failure, smoke on board and death of a hostess (near Graz).
- 25 from December: Azerbaijan Embraer 190 – Accident after being shot down (Cerca de Aktau, Kazakhán).
- 27 from December: PAL Express De Havilland Dash 8-400 – Track outlet (Bacolod City).
- 28 from December: KLM Boeing 737-800 – Hydr problemsáULICOS AND TRACK OUTPUT (Oslo).
- 28 from December: PAL De Havilland Dash 8-400 – Main landing train collapse (Halifax).
- 29 from December: Jeju Air Boeing 737-800 – Landing with the train above and track outlet (Muan, South Korea).
- January 2025:
- 7 from January: Emerald UK ATR 72 – Front landing train landing and collapse (Belfast).
- 8 from January: TUI Boeing 737 – Front landing train collapse (Brussels).
- 10 from January: Delta Boeing 757-300 – Motor failure abortion (Atlanta).
- 19 from January: Qantas Airbus A330-200 – Smoke in cabin (near Cairns).
- 20 from January: Karun Airlines Fokker 100 – Andñus a neumáTicos during takeoff and landing (Syrian a teharerán).
- 21 from January: Kasai Airlines Antonov An-26 – Track outlet (Congolo).
- 28 from January: Busan Air Airbus A321 – Fire during take -off preparations (Busan).
- 28 from January: Max Air Boeing 737-400 – Front landing train collapse (Kano).
- 29 from January: PSA Bombardier CRJ700 – Colisión in the air with a helicóptero (Washington).
- 29 from January: Eagle Beechcraft 1900 – Accident (Bentiu).
- 31 from January: Learjet 55 – Accident (Philadelphia).
